SAN FRANCISCO A popular, fast-growing chain, known for its chicken-tender meals, is poised to land at one of the Bay Area’s biggest tourist draws.

Raising Cane’s has its sights on a new location in the heart of San Francisco’s historic Fisherman’s Wharf.

Heart of Fisherman’s Wharf

What we know:

The Louisiana-based chain has filed permits for the space at 211 Jefferson Street at Taylor Street, according to Fisherman’s Wharf Community Benefit District Director of Communications Cecile Gregoire.
